Grandma in Blue with Red Hat

Grandma in Blue with Red Hat PDF Author: Scott Menchin
Publisher: Abrams
ISBN: 161312743X
Category : Juvenile Fiction
Languages : en
Pages : 40

Get Book Here

Book Description
When a young boy learns about what makes art special—sometimes it’s beautiful, sometimes it’s funny, sometimes it tells a story—he realizes that these same characteristics are what make his grandmother special, too. As a result, he finds the inspiration to create his own masterpiece that’s one of a kind. Christopher Award–winning author Scott Menchin and New York Times bestselling illustrator Harry Bliss have teamed up for a celebration of the power of art and expression, and the extraordinary love between grandparent and child.

Grandma Calls Me Beautiful

Grandma Calls Me Beautiful PDF Author: Barbara M. Joosse
Publisher: Chronicle Books
ISBN: 9780811858151
Category : Juvenile Nonfiction
Languages : en
Pages : 44

Get Book Here

Book Description
A Hawaiian grandmother tells her granddaughter a favorite story about how much she loves her. Includes a glossary with definitions and explanations of Hawaiian words and customs and illustrated instructions for an Hawaiian string design, "hei" you can play.

Don't Call Me Grandma

Don't Call Me Grandma PDF Author: Vaunda Micheaux Nelson
Publisher: Carolrhoda Books
ISBN: 1467795593
Category : Juvenile Fiction
Languages : en
Pages : 40

Get Book Here

Book Description
Great-grandmother Nell eats fish for breakfast, she doesn't hug or kiss, and she does NOT want to be called grandma. Her great-granddaughter isn't sure what to think about her. As she slowly learns more about Nell's life and experiences, the girl finds ways to connect with her prickly great-grandmother.
